Thomas Reservoir is located in Boulder County, Colorado, and is a popular fishing destination. The reservoir is home to various fish species such as bass, bluegill, catfish, and trout. Nearby activities include hiking, biking, and bird watching. When fishing at Thomas Reservoir, it's recommended to use bait such as worms, power bait, and spinners. The best time of year to visit for fishing is during the spring and fall months with average temperatures of 55 to 70 degrees Fahrenheit.
